Skripty při uložení: Porovnání verzí
Skočit na navigaci
Skočit na vyhledávání
m (naimportována 1 revize) |
|||
Řádek 2: | Řádek 2: | ||
* MTBScriptBeforeStoreDocumentContent | * MTBScriptBeforeStoreDocumentContent | ||
* MTBScriptAfterStoreDocumentContent | * MTBScriptAfterStoreDocumentContent | ||
− | Pokud tedy např. proměnná | + | Pokud tedy např. proměnná MTBScriptAfterStoreDocumentContent obsahuje hodnotu "ProcesUlozen", pak dojde před uložením změn procesu k vypsání textu "Proces byl uložen". <br/><br/> |
− | Skript musí | + | Skript musí nastavit výsledek True nebo False. Dle toho pak dojde či nedojde k uložení změn vygenerovaných skriptem. |
Verze z 10. 7. 2019, 12:26
Při uložení procesu je možné zavolat automatické vykonání skriptu. Výběr skriptu je proveden hodnotou proměnných
- MTBScriptBeforeStoreDocumentContent
- MTBScriptAfterStoreDocumentContent
Pokud tedy např. proměnná MTBScriptAfterStoreDocumentContent obsahuje hodnotu "ProcesUlozen", pak dojde před uložením změn procesu k vypsání textu "Proces byl uložen".
Skript musí nastavit výsledek True nebo False. Dle toho pak dojde či nedojde k uložení změn vygenerovaných skriptem.
Script ProcesUlozen (): Boolean Begin Document.addText("Proces byl uložen") Result := True End
Zpět na stránku Skriptovací jazyk